Mushrooms In Madeira Sauce
(Champignons Sautes, Sauce Madere)
What You Need:
  • ½ pound mushrooms, washed and sliced
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• ½ cup chopped green onion
  • 3 tablespoons butter
  • 3 tablespoons flour
  • 2 teaspoons (or cubes) beef bouillon concentrate
  • 1 teaspoon Kitchen Bouquet
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 1/8 teaspoon thyme
  • 1 tablespoon tomato paste (or ¼ cup tomato sauce)
  • 2 cups water
  • ¼ cup Madeira wine

  • How To Cook:
    1. Put the mushrooms and 2 tablespoons butter in a covered casserole and cook in the microwave oven for 4 minutes. Stir in the green onion. Cook, covered, 1 minute more in the microwave oven. Set aside.

    2. Melt the butter in a 1-quart casserole. Stir in the flour, bouillon concentrate, Kitchen Bouquet, salt, thyme and tomato paste. Gradually blend in the water. Stir in the wine.

    3. Cook, covered, in the microwave oven until the mixture comes to a boil (about 6 minutes), stirring from time-to-time during the last 3 minutes.

    4. Stir in the mushrooms and onions and cook, covered, 1 minute more.

    To Make: 3 cups
